Current Opportunity: Principal and Chief Executive - City of Bristol College
12th August 2019
AoC - Executive Recruitment team are delighted to be supporting City of Bristol College with the appointment of a new Principal and Chief Executive
City of Bristol College is on the brink of significant transformation and success. A large further and higher education college offering a wide range of academic and vocational programmes across four main centres, they are committed to creating lifetime opportunities across their communities, while enhancing local prosperity. The college is based at the heart of a vibrant, economically robust city which prioritises education and skills through its visionary Learning City strategy.
Following a challenging period for the college, City of Bristol College are currently on a positive turnaround journey with significant successes already achieved
They are seeking a new Principal and Chief Executive who will play a strategic role in positioning the college as the jewel in the crown of their dynamic city. The new leader will raise the college’s external profile with key stakeholders across the city and beyond, developing strong relationships with business, city and community partners and ensuring that opportunities for development and growth are maximised. Key to success will be ensuring ongoing high-quality provision and financial sustainability, while developing and motivating a talented senior leadership team and inspiring their workforce.
